01 -
Turn your oven to 400°F and let it heat up. Put some butter on your muffin tin to keep things from sticking. Squash cinnamon rolls into each cup and make little pockets for the filling.
02 -
Combine the diced apples, brown sugar, cinnamon, lemon juice, melted butter, and the cornstarch mixture. Microwave it until the apples soften up and it thickens.
03 -
Stir together the butter, flour, brown sugar, and cinnamon until everything clumps into crumbs.
04 -
Spoon the cooked apple mixture (strain out the extra liquid first) into the cinnamon roll pockets. Sprinkle the crumbly streusel on top.
05 -
Cover the muffin tin loosely with foil. Bake for 5 minutes, then take off the foil, turn the pan, and bake 10 minutes more.
06 -
Mix the butter, powdered sugar, milk, cinnamon, and vanilla in a bowl until it's smooth.
07 -
Let the cinnamon roll cups cool for about 5-10 minutes. Drizzle the icing over the top.
